1. Identify Your Photography Style
Before you start searching, decide what style of photography best suits your wedding vision. Popular wedding photography styles include:
Traditional Photography – Classic and posed portraits with a timeless feel.
Documentary Photography – Candid, unposed shots that capture real emotions and interactions.
Fine Art Photography – Artistic and soft-focused images with creative lighting.
Editorial Photography – High-fashion, magazine-style wedding portraits.
Adventure Photography – Perfect for couples eloping or having outdoor weddings, making use of New Zealand’s stunning landscapes.
Look at wedding photo inspiration on Pinterest, Instagram, and photography blogs to see which style resonates with you.

3. Review Portfolios and Past Work
A photographer’s portfolio is a reflection of their skill and creativity. When reviewing portfolios, look for:
Consistency – Do their images maintain the same high quality across different weddings?
Lighting & Composition – Are the photos well-lit, properly framed, and visually appealing?
Emotion & Storytelling – Do the images capture real emotions and meaningful moments?
Variety – Are they skilled in capturing both posed and candid shots?
Don’t just rely on highlight reels; ask to see full wedding galleries to assess how they document an entire event from start to finish.
4. Compare Wedding Photography Packages & Pricing
Wedding photography costs in New Zealand vary depending on experience, location, and what’s included in the package.
Average Wedding Photography Prices in NZ:
Package Type
Price Range
Inclusions
Basic Package
$1,500 – $2,500
4-6 hours of coverage, digital images, basic editing
Standard Package
$2,500 – $5,000
8-10 hours of coverage, a second photographer, full wedding album
Premium Package
$5,000 – $8,000+
Full-day coverage, engagement session, luxury album, drone photography
Tips for Choosing the Best Package:
✔️ Decide how many hours of coverage you need.
✔️ Check if the package includes prints, albums, or only digital files.
✔️ Ask if you can customize a package to fit your budget and needs.
5. Schedule a Consultation Before Booking
Once you’ve shortlisted your top choices, schedule a consultation (either in-person or virtual). This is an opportunity to:
Discuss your wedding vision and photography expectations.
Ensure your personalities align (since your photographer will be with you throughout the day).
Confirm package details, payment terms, and contract agreements.
Important Questions to Ask Your Photographer:
How many weddings have you photographed in New Zealand?
What’s included in your wedding photography package?
Have you worked at my wedding venue before?
What’s your backup plan in case of bad weather or technical issues?
How long will it take to receive my final edited photos?
Can I request specific shots or a shot list?
Booking early (at least 6-12 months in advance) ensures you secure your preferred photographer, especially for peak wedding seasons.
